While the longest phone call record is a benchmark of sustained conversation, there are other impressive feats in the realm of communication. The largest telephone conference call included 16,972 participants in an event organized by Broadnet Teleservices (USA) on December 12, 2012, in Highlands Ranch, Colorado, USA. All the participants were on the call concurrently for at least 10 seconds, demonstrating the capacity for large-scale, coordinated communication.
